The confirmed line-up of riders set to compete at the history-making Red Bull Featured event has been announced today. British Olympic silver medalist Kieran Reilly, 8x X-Games gold medalist Ryan Williams and British 2024 European Champion, Sasha Pardoe are part of the star-studded line up set to take on the all new competition format at the iconic Manchester Central on 12th April 2025. These exciting names in the sport are being challenged to push the limits of what’s possible and try to land a world-first trick in front of a crowd. In an all new format, created by BMX legend and Red Bull athlete Sebastian Keep, each rider is given a unique opportunity to attempt major tricks, without being penalised by judges if they fall.
The adrenaline-fuelled event will not only involve a thrilling BMX showcase, but those in attendance will also be able to get their hands on the exclusive merchandise and enjoy live music with a special half-time performance. The atmosphere will be electric as fans will be closer to the ramps than in a normal competition, with the chance to get up close to their favourite riders as they enjoy the action from an innovative viewing platform specially made
for this groundbreaking new format.
The Prince of Peckham, Kye Whyte goes Full Circle and Returns to Supercross BMX! In 2008 Kye Whyte Doubled and picked up British Champion #1 Plates in Class and Cruiser while riding for Supercross BMX / Alans Factory Team, and now in 2025 he makes his return to Supercross BMX signing on thru the 2028 LA Games and Beyond.
To have the 2020 Silver Medalist choose to come back to Supercross BMX to finish his career is a dream for us - Said Supercross BMX Owner and Founder Bill Ryan.
As we enter into 2025 as our 36th year of Supercross, having our Legacy riders of Bubba Harris and Maris Strombergs as the Team Captains, and adding Kye Whyte in as our Premier Elite along with Vicente Garcia and Lexis Colby, is starting to show the world our Vision of “Wait Til you See Whats Next”
